How to evaluate and choose the best snapshotting and cloning tools for operating system images.
To select top snapshotting and cloning tools for OS images, systematically compare features, performance, reliability, and ecosystem support, balancing risk, cost, and future growth against your organization's unique needs and constraints.
July 16, 2025
Facebook X Reddit
Snapshotting and cloning tools for operating system images serve as foundational infrastructure for backup, deployment, and disaster recovery. When evaluating options, start with core capabilities: whether a tool can capture a clean state without halting services, support for incremental or differential imaging, and the ability to restore to bare metal, virtual machines, or cloud instances. Consider portability across hardware architectures and file systems, since OS images often traverse diverse environments. Reliability matters: look for deterministic restores, verification checksums, and integrated testing. Performance is practical: measure how long a snapshot takes, how resource-intensive it is, and if it can run concurrently with production workloads. Security and access control should be embedded from the outset.
Beyond foundational capabilities, assess ease of use and automation potential. A strong tool provides clear commands, robust scripting interfaces, and well-documented APIs for integration into CI/CD pipelines or runbooks. Look for scheduling, event-triggered snapshots, and templating so you can standardize image creation across teams. The ability to tag, catalog, and search images helps maintain an organized repository. Consider interoperability with configuration management systems, hypervisors, container platforms, and cloud providers. Documentation quality matters because operators will rely on it during incidents. Finally, evaluate the vendor’s roadmap to ensure the product will evolve with emerging storage technologies and compliance requirements.
Evaluate reliability, security, and ecosystem compatibility together.
A practical evaluation begins by mapping your current environment and future plans. Inventory hardware platforms, virtualization layers, and cloud destinations where OS images will land. Identify the most critical use cases, whether it’s rapid provisioning, migration between data centers, or regular testing of fresh OS instances. Then draft concrete acceptance criteria: restore time objectives, image fidelity, support for encryption at rest and in transit, and non-disruptive backup windows. Engage stakeholders across security, operations, and application teams to ensure alignment. Document expected outcomes, then run a pilot project with two or three representative systems. Use the results to quantify performance, reliability, and any uncovered gaps before broader rollouts.
ADVERTISEMENT
ADVERTISEMENT
The pilot should simulate real-world scenarios to reveal practical limitations. Test cold and warm restores, verify integrity with checksums, and validate multi-user access controls. Experiment with different storage backends, such as local disks, NAS, object storage, and cloud snapshots, because storage latency and throughput directly impact recovery times. Try disaster scenarios like partial failures or network outages to observe how the tool handles resume and retry logic. Record metrics including snapshot duration, CPU and I/O spikes, and the impact on running services. Conclude with a clear report that translates technical results into business implications and recommended actions for securing a dependable image workflow.
Practical testing and cost analysis guide informed comparisons.
Compatibility is more than feature parity; it’s about ecosystem integration. Ensure the snapshot tool interoperates with your hypervisor technology, container orchestrator, and operating system variants used across the fleet. If you maintain hybrid environments, confirm cross-platform image portability and consistent metadata handling. Image catalogs should support role-based access control, retention policies, and automated cleanup. Consider whether the tool offers test environments or sandboxes that mirror production configurations, enabling safe experimentation. Check for compatibility with configuration journaling and change tracking to simplify auditing. Finally, verify update cadence and vendor responsiveness to security advisories, firmware issues, and interoperability notes that arise after deployment.
ADVERTISEMENT
ADVERTISEMENT
Cost considerations extend beyond initial licensing. Tally upfront software costs, ongoing maintenance, and support tiers. Factor in storage expenses for image repositories and the overhead of running snapshot operations on live systems. Evaluate license models that fit growth plans—per-node, per-CPU, or per- instance—and whether there are fees for deduplication, compression, or cloud egress. Examine training requirements and the time needed for teams to reach proficiency. Finally, compare total cost of ownership against expected downtime reductions, deployment speed improvements, and risk mitigation to determine the return on investment.
Trackable metrics and documented plans drive confident decisions.
In-depth testing helps distinguish tools with similar feature sets. Create a controlled test lab that mirrors your production constraints, including data volumes, network bandwidth, and security policies. Run a sequence of image creation, verification, and deployment tasks, noting any failures and recovery times. Assess how the tool handles concurrent operations across multiple teams and projects. Evaluate the ease of restoring to different environments, such as bare metal, virtual machines, or cloud instances. Document edge cases, such as very large images, sparse file systems, or missing drivers. Gather feedback from operators to identify usability gaps and opportunities for automation enhancements.
Documentation quality and community support can determine long-term success. A clear user guide reduces missteps during critical incidents, while tutorials and sample pipelines accelerate adoption. Look for explicit troubleshooting sections, schema definitions for image catalogs, and examples of common automation scenarios. A healthy ecosystem includes active forums, knowledge bases, and responsive official support. If the vendor offers professional services, compare rates and availability against your internal capability. Finally, review compatibility notes and migration guides that ease transitions when you upgrade the underlying OS or storage hardware.
ADVERTISEMENT
ADVERTISEMENT
Final decision criteria summarize practical and strategic fit.
When you formalize vendor evaluation, establish a scoring framework that weights each criterion by its strategic importance. Include objective measures such as restore time, data integrity verification pass rates, and automation success rates in pipelines. Add subjective factors like operator experience, ease of use, and perceived risk. Use the pilot results to populate the scoring matrix, then normalize values so comparisons remain fair across different environments. A transparent decision process reduces post-purchase friction and improves cross-team buy-in. Finally, document risk assessments and contingency plans in case a chosen tool encounters compatibility or performance issues after deployment.
The best choice often balances immediacy with long-term resilience. Favor tools that offer incremental backups and efficient differencing, which minimize window impact during normal operations. Ensure there is a clear rollback path and reliable verification that images remain usable after lengthy storage intervals. Long-term resilience also means considering disaster recovery choreography: automated failover, tested restore playbooks, and cross-region replication if needed. Factor in vendor stability and cloud strategy alignment, because a tool tied to a single platform can become a bottleneck. In the end, the right tool should empower rapid recovery without compromising security or governance.
After thorough testing and cost analysis, draft a decision memo that aligns technical findings with organizational goals. Include a prioritized list of must-haves, nice-to-haves, and non-negotiables. Present concrete scenarios illustrating how the chosen tool will perform under pressure, during migrations, or after a breach. Address compliance considerations, such as data sovereignty, encryption standards, and auditability. Outline an implementation roadmap with milestones, responsible owners, and risk mitigations. Communicate the plan to stakeholders across IT, security, and business units to ensure clarity and accountability. A well-documented rationale helps secure funding and accelerates smooth adoption.
With alignment secured, proceed to a phased deployment that emphasizes governance and learning. Start by establishing a small, stable baseline environment, then gradually scale to cover all critical systems. Maintain ongoing validation procedures: periodic restore tests, catalog integrity checks, and reviews of access controls. Foster a culture of continuous improvement by collecting operator feedback and updating automation scripts. Schedule regular reviews of performance metrics and security posture to catch regressions early. A mature snapshotting and cloning strategy becomes not just a toolset but a disciplined practice that underpins reliable operations, faster deployments, and durable data protection for the organization.
Related Articles
A practical, evergreen guide that helps readers weigh hardware, software, and policy choices to safeguard data on phones, tablets, and laptops across Windows, macOS, Linux, iOS, and Android.
July 26, 2025
This article outlines rigorous, repeatable strategies for evaluating accessibility features across major operating systems, ensuring inclusive software experiences, and aligning testing with evolving standards, tools, and user needs.
July 17, 2025
Keeping container runtimes and orchestration tools updated without causing downtime requires disciplined processes, robust automation, and proactive testing. This evergreen guide outlines practical, repeatable steps that teams can adopt to minimize disruption, maintain security, and preserve service level objectives while embracing essential upgrades across diverse environments and deployment models.
August 08, 2025
A practical, evergreen guide detailing layered hardware and software strategies to secure boot sequences, firmware integrity, and system trust, ensuring resilience against tampering and malicious firmware updates across devices.
July 15, 2025
This evergreen guide explains practical strategies for governing transient cloud and on-premises compute, balancing cost efficiency with compatibility across multiple operating systems, deployment patterns, and automation that respects varied workloads and governance needs.
July 24, 2025
Learn practical, enduring strategies to watch disk health across devices, implement reliable monitoring routines, and replace failing drives before data loss occurs, ensuring continuous access, backup integrity, and system resilience.
July 19, 2025
This evergreen guide explains why lightweight, purposefully isolated operating systems improve IoT security, how to select them, and how to maintain continuous updates to defend against evolving threats.
July 19, 2025
An enduring guide explains how smart operating system configurations can curb overheating, sustain performance, extend battery life, and protect hardware, offering practical steps, timing, and balance between cooling and usability.
July 15, 2025
A practical guide to building stable, auditable infrastructure through immutable images, automated deployments, and disciplined change management that reduces drift and accelerates recovery.
August 07, 2025
This evergreen exploration dives into filesystem caching techniques and I/O scheduler tuning, revealing practical strategies to balance latency, throughput, and system stability across diverse workloads.
July 23, 2025
Effective boot sequencing hinges on clear dependency mapping, correct ordering, and robust failure handling, guiding services from essential initialization to progressive readiness while maintaining system stability across diverse environments.
August 07, 2025
Regular validation and testing of disaster recovery procedures ensures operating system readiness, resilience, and rapid restoration, minimizing downtime, data loss, and impact on critical services through disciplined, repeatable practice.
July 16, 2025
In cloud native environments, reducing attack surfaces hinges on disciplined OS hardening, layered defenses, proactive monitoring, and ongoing validation. By aligning OS controls with container runtime policies, teams can diminish exploitation opportunities, improve resilience, and accelerate secure deployment without sacrificing agility or scale.
July 16, 2025
A practical guide to constructing portable, repeatable build environments that work across Windows, macOS, and Linux, enabling teams to collaborate efficiently without compatibility surprises, drift, or vendor lock-in.
July 23, 2025
Exploring a practical, cross-platform approach to identifying, evaluating, and mitigating security risks from third-party dependencies within diverse operating system environments.
August 04, 2025
This evergreen guide explains practical, cross‑platform strategies to establish secure default permissions for new files and folders, ensuring minimal exposure while preserving usability across Linux, Windows, and macOS environments.
August 09, 2025
This evergreen guide delves into practical, end-to-end steps for hardening default OS settings, addressing attackers’ favored weaknesses, while preserving usability and performance across modern environments.
July 23, 2025
A practical guide to building a cross-platform access audit system that reliably records, normalizes, and analyzes critical events across diverse operating systems, ensuring auditability, compliance, and rapid incident response.
July 19, 2025
Organizations seeking stronger security must design, implement, and maintain role based access control and least privilege across every operating system service, aligning permissions with real job requirements while minimizing risk exposure and operational friction.
July 31, 2025
A practical, evergreen guide detailing resilient boot processes, recovery workflows, and cross-platform strategies that help users safeguard startup integrity, diagnose boot failures, and restore systems with minimal downtime.
July 14, 2025